Inorganic‐based flexible light‐emitting diodes (LEDs) using single‐crystalline GaN/ZnO coaxial nanorod heterostructures grown directly on large graphene films are reported on page 4614 by Gyu‐Chul Yi and co‐workers. The LEDs demon‐strate reliable operation in a flexible form, with no significant degradation in their electroluminescent or electrical characteristics. This approach provides a general and rational route to develop many different inorganic optoelectronics in flexible or stretchable forms.
